One of the most potent crypto wealth hacks is Strategic Staking and Yield Farming. Staking involves locking up your cryptocurrency holdings to support the operations of a blockchain network, earning you rewards in return. Think of it as earning interest, but often at significantly higher rates than traditional savings accounts. Yield farming takes this a step further. It's the practice of lending your crypto assets to decentralized finance (DeFi) protocols to earn rewards. These protocols facilitate various financial services – lending, borrowing, trading – and pay users for providing liquidity. The potential returns can be astronomical, but they also come with higher risks, including impermanent loss and smart contract vulnerabilities. The hack here is diversification and meticulous research. Don't put all your eggs in one basket. Understand the underlying protocols, the risks associated with each, and the APYs (Annual Percentage Yields) being offered. A well-diversified portfolio across various staking and yield farming opportunities can create a robust passive income stream.

Another game-changer is Leveraging Decentralized Exchanges (DEXs) for Arbitrage Opportunities. Arbitrage is the simultaneous buying and selling of an asset in different markets to profit from tiny differences in the asset's listed price. In the crypto world, DEXs, with their myriad trading pairs and global reach, present fertile ground for arbitrage. Prices for the same cryptocurrency can fluctuate between different DEXs due to varying liquidity, trading volume, and market inefficiencies. Advanced traders use bots to scan these markets in real-time, executing trades within milliseconds to capture these small price discrepancies. The "hack" is in the speed and efficiency of execution. For individuals without sophisticated bot setups, manual arbitrage is still possible for larger price differences, but it requires constant market monitoring and quick decision-making. The key is to identify reliable DEXs, understand transaction fees, and calculate potential profit margins accurately before executing.

Furthermore, Mastering Layer 2 Scaling Solutions can unlock significant cost savings and faster transaction speeds, indirectly boosting your wealth-building efforts. Many popular blockchains, like Ethereum, face congestion issues, leading to high transaction fees (gas fees). Layer 2 solutions (e.g., Polygon, Arbitrum, Optimism) are built on top of these blockchains to process transactions off-chain, then batch them and submit them back to the main chain. By utilizing these solutions for your DeFi activities, trading, or even simple transfers, you drastically reduce costs. This means more of your capital remains invested and less is spent on transaction fees, allowing your investments to compound more effectively. The hack is to be platform-agnostic and always choose the most cost-effective and efficient network for your transactions, especially when dealing with frequent small trades or DeFi interactions.

Finally, for those with a knack for understanding market dynamics, DCA (Dollar-Cost Averaging) in Crypto and Strategic DCA with Emerging Assets can be a powerful long-term wealth hack. Instead of trying to time the market, DCA involves investing a fixed amount of money at regular intervals, regardless of the asset's price. This strategy helps mitigate the risk of buying at a market peak and smooths out the average cost of your holdings over time. The "hack" here is to combine DCA with intelligent asset selection. While applying DCA to established cryptocurrencies like Bitcoin and Ethereum is a solid strategy, consider applying it with a higher risk tolerance to carefully selected emerging altcoins that show strong fundamentals, innovative technology, or significant community adoption. This allows you to benefit from the stability of DCA while also positioning yourself for potentially explosive growth from promising new projects. The key is rigorous research to identify these emerging assets, understanding their whitepapers, team, and tokenomics, and committing to a long-term investment horizon.

One of the most sophisticated wealth hacks is Participating in Initial Coin Offerings (ICOs), Initial Exchange Offerings (IEOs), and Initial DEX Offerings (IDOs). These are essentially ways to invest in new crypto projects at their earliest stages, often before they hit major exchanges. ICOs are direct offerings from the project, IEOs are conducted through a cryptocurrency exchange, and IDOs are launched on decentralized exchanges. The hack lies in identifying promising projects with strong use cases, innovative technology, and reputable teams before they gain widespread attention. The potential for exponential returns is immense, as many successful projects have seen their token values skyrocket post-launch. However, this is also one of the riskiest areas. The market is rife with scams and poorly conceived projects. Thorough due diligence is paramount: scrutinize the whitepaper, the team's experience, the project's roadmap, and community sentiment. Diversifying your investments across multiple early-stage projects, rather than concentrating on one, can mitigate some of the inherent risk. Understanding the tokenomics – how the token is distributed, its utility, and supply – is also crucial for assessing long-term value.

Beyond direct investment, Becoming a Liquidity Provider (LP) on Decentralized Exchanges presents a powerful passive income hack. When you provide liquidity to a DEX's trading pool (e.g., ETH/USDC), you enable others to trade between those two assets. In return, you earn a share of the trading fees generated by that pool. This is the engine behind yield farming, as mentioned earlier, but it can be approached with a more focused strategy. The wealth hack here is selecting pools with high trading volume and potentially lucrative fee structures. You're essentially acting as a decentralized bank, facilitating trades and earning interest. The primary risk to consider is impermanent loss – the potential for your assets to decrease in value compared to simply holding them, especially if one asset in the pair experiences a significant price swing relative to the other. To hack this, experienced LPs often focus on stablecoin pairs or pairs where the price correlation is more predictable, or they actively manage their positions to mitigate impermanent loss.

The world of Decentralized Autonomous Organizations (DAOs) offers a unique and evolving wealth hack – the ability to earn from governance and community participation. DAOs are blockchain-based organizations governed by token holders. By acquiring the governance tokens of a DAO, you gain the right to vote on proposals that shape the project's future. Many DAOs reward active participants and token holders with additional tokens or other benefits. The wealth hack is to identify DAOs that are actively governed, have strong community engagement, and whose proposals are driving genuine innovation and growth. Participating in governance, contributing to discussions, and even developing proposals can not only earn you rewards but also provide deep insights into the project's trajectory, allowing for more informed investment decisions. Some DAOs even offer grants or funding for contributors, creating direct income streams.

For the more technically inclined or creatively minded, Exploring Decentralized Finance (DeFi) Lending and Borrowing Platforms can be a lucrative hack. You can lend your crypto assets to earn interest, similar to staking, but often with more flexibility in terms of asset availability and lending duration. Conversely, you can borrow assets, which can be used for various strategies. For example, one could borrow stablecoins against their volatile crypto holdings to hedge against market downturns, or even use borrowed funds to invest in new opportunities with the expectation of higher returns than the borrowing interest rate (a more advanced and risky strategy). The wealth hack is understanding the risk-reward of different lending platforms, the collateralization ratios required for borrowing, and the interest rates offered. Utilizing stablecoins for lending can provide a more predictable income stream, while borrowing requires careful management to avoid liquidation.

One of the most compelling applications of blockchain in financial leverage is through collateralized lending. In DeFi, users can lock up their cryptocurrency assets as collateral to borrow other digital assets, often stablecoins (cryptocurrencies pegged to the value of fiat currencies like the US dollar). Protocols like Aave, Compound, and MakerDAO have become pioneers in this space. For instance, a user holding a substantial amount of Ether (ETH) could deposit it into a lending pool on Aave. Based on the value of their ETH, they can then borrow a certain percentage of that value in DAI, a stablecoin issued by MakerDAO. This is akin to using your home as collateral for a mortgage, but executed entirely within the digital realm, without the need for a bank appraisal or a lengthy approval process. The collateral ratio – the ratio of collateral value to loan value – is crucial here, ensuring that lenders are protected even if the value of the collateral experiences a significant downturn. Smart contracts automatically monitor this ratio, and if it falls below a predetermined threshold, the collateral can be liquidated to repay the loan, mitigating risk for the lender.

The transparency of blockchain is another game-changer. Every transaction, every collateral deposit, every loan issuance, and every liquidation is recorded on the public ledger, visible to anyone. This radical transparency fosters trust and accountability, reducing the information asymmetry that often plagues traditional finance. Investors can scrutinize the health of a lending protocol, examine the collateralization levels of loans, and understand the risk parameters involved. This level of insight empowers individuals to make more informed decisions about their leverage strategies, moving away from opaque black boxes and towards a more democratized understanding of financial mechanisms.

Furthermore, blockchain enables the tokenization of assets, which can then be used as collateral for leverage. Imagine fractional ownership of real estate, art, or even intellectual property being represented by digital tokens on a blockchain. These tokens can then be used in DeFi protocols to secure loans, unlocking liquidity from traditionally illiquid assets. This opens up a vast new pool of collateral, democratizing access to leverage for a wider range of individuals and businesses who might not have traditional assets to pledge. The ability to leverage tokenized assets broadens the scope of financial instruments and investment opportunities, making sophisticated financial tools accessible to a much larger audience.

The concept of "flash loans" is another fascinating, albeit higher-risk, innovation powered by blockchain leverage. Flash loans allow users to borrow massive amounts of cryptocurrency without providing any collateral, provided the loan is repaid within the same transaction block. This might sound like magic, but it's a testament to the power of smart contracts. These loans are typically used by developers and arbitrageurs to execute complex strategies, such as taking advantage of price discrepancies across different decentralized exchanges (DEXs) or performing collateral swaps. While not for the faint of heart, flash loans highlight the extreme flexibility and potential for innovative financial engineering that blockchain-based leverage unlocks. The speed and programmability inherent in blockchain make such instantaneous, collateral-free borrowing possible, a feat unimaginable in traditional finance.

The concept of "over-collateralization" is a key risk management mechanism in DeFi leverage. Unlike traditional loans where the value of collateral might be scrutinized once, DeFi protocols constantly monitor the value of the locked assets relative to the borrowed amount. This dynamic risk assessment, executed by smart contracts, ensures that lenders are protected even in volatile market conditions. If the value of the collateral drops below a certain threshold (the liquidation point), the smart contract automatically triggers a liquidation process, selling enough of the collateral to cover the outstanding loan and any associated fees. This automated liquidation mechanism is far more efficient and less susceptible to human error or bias than traditional foreclosure or repossession processes. It provides a robust safety net for lenders, making decentralized lending a more attractive proposition.

Furthermore, blockchain facilitates the creation of novel leveraged products and strategies. Beyond simple collateralized loans, we are seeing the emergence of leveraged tokens, which offer amplified exposure to underlying cryptocurrency assets without requiring users to manage their own collateral directly. These tokens are often created by specialized DeFi protocols that employ smart contracts to manage a portfolio of leveraged positions. For example, a user might purchase a "3x long Bitcoin" token, which aims to provide three times the daily return of Bitcoin, minus fees. While these products offer the allure of amplified gains, they also come with magnified risks, including the potential for rapid and significant losses, especially in volatile markets. The transparency of the underlying smart contracts, however, allows users to understand, to a degree, how these leveraged products function and the risks they entail, a stark contrast to the often opaque derivative products in traditional finance.

However, it's imperative to acknowledge the inherent risks associated with blockchain financial leverage. The rapid pace of innovation means that platforms and protocols are constantly evolving, and with this evolution comes the potential for smart contract vulnerabilities and bugs. Hacks and exploits have resulted in significant losses for users in the past, underscoring the need for robust security audits and due diligence by investors. The volatility of cryptocurrencies themselves poses a substantial risk; leveraged positions, which amplify both gains and losses, can quickly turn against an investor if the underlying asset experiences a sharp price decline. The regulatory landscape for DeFi and blockchain-based leverage is also still developing, creating a degree of uncertainty. Governments and financial authorities worldwide are grappling with how to regulate these decentralized systems, and future regulatory changes could have a significant impact on the industry.
